One cup of Pea noodles is around 250 grams and contains approximately 892 calories, 54 grams of protein, 6.2 grams of fat, and 159 grams of carbohydrates.

Pea Noodles are a delightful and nutritious alternative to traditional pasta, crafted from green pea flour. Originating from the heart of Asian cuisine, these vibrant noodles offer a unique, slightly sweet flavor and a tender yet chewy texture. Packed with protein and fiber, Pea Noodles provide a wholesome boost while being gluten-free, making them a perfect choice for those with dietary restrictions. Their versatility allows them to shine in stir-fries, soups, or salads, delivering a satisfying meal that supports a healthy lifestyle.
